Novel projection welding base
By designing a new projection welding fixture and clamping plate structure for the projection welding base, the problem of difficulty in matching the inner hole of the projection welding base with the connecting shaft was solved, realizing a simple and efficient projection welding process, reducing costs and expanding the scope of application.

Technical Field
[0001] This utility model relates to shock absorbers, and more particularly to a novel projection weld base. Background Technology
[0002] For shock absorbers that require projection welding of connecting shafts, the existing projection welding base inner hole cannot match the connecting shaft (φ26mm), especially when the inner and outer diameters of the two are not much different. After installing the projection welding machine, it is impossible to perform projection welding on the bottom cover of the liquid storage tank. Summary of the Invention
[0003] To solve the technical problem that the inner hole cannot match the connecting shaft, this utility model provides a novel projection welding base.
[0004] The technical solution of this utility model is as follows:
[0005] A novel projection welding base includes a projection welding fixture. The upper part of the projection welding fixture has an upper groove, and the lower part of the projection welding fixture has a lower groove. A threaded connection of the projection welding fixture is provided between the upper groove and the lower groove. A clamping plate is separated from the lower part of the projection welding fixture by a center cut. A connecting shaft is placed inside the projection welding fixture. The notch of the projection welding fixture and the clamping plate are locked together by bolts.
[0006] The clamping plate is no more than 2mm away from the notch of the projection welding fixture on both sides.
[0007] The top surface of the lower groove is on the same plane as the cutting line.
[0008] Two mounting holes are provided on both sides of the lower groove, and four bolts are provided in the mounting holes.

[0012] like Figure 1 , 2A novel projection welding base shown in Figures 3 and 4 includes a projection welding fixture 1. The projection welding fixture 1 has an upper groove on its upper part and a lower groove on its lower part. A projection welding fixture threaded connection 2 is provided between the upper groove and the lower groove. The inner wall of the projection welding fixture threaded connection 2 is stepped. A clamping plate 5 is separated from the lower part of the projection welding fixture 1 by a central cut. A connecting shaft is placed inside the projection welding fixture 1. The notch of the projection welding fixture 1 and the clamping plate 5 are locked together by bolts 6.
[0013] The clamping plate 5 is no more than 2mm away from the notch of the projection welding fixture 1 on both sides. The dividing line separates the clamping plate 5 and cuts off a length of no more than 2mm from the two contacting sides, leaving a distance to offset the increase in the outer diameter of the connecting shaft, and to ensure that the clamping plate 5 does not bulge outward as much as possible.
[0014] The top surface of the lower groove is on the same plane as the cutting line.
[0015] Two mounting holes are provided on both sides of the lower groove, and four bolts 6 are provided in the mounting holes.
[0016] When in use, the distance between the notch on both sides of the clamping plate 5 and the projection welding fixture 1 is to match the connecting shaft with a larger outer diameter, and to prevent the clamping plate 5 from protruding outward, which would affect the appearance. This accessory has high versatility. It uses the clamping plate 5 and bolt 6 locking design, and can be used in cases where the outer diameter of the connecting shaft is not much different. It is simple to install, easy to process, and reduces costs.
